Bishop Mkrtich Proshyan Sends Letter from Prison
Bishop Mkrtich Proshyan, the detained leader of the Aragatsotn Diocese, has sent his first letter from prison, emphasizing the unwavering strength of faith. He stated that justice may be temporarily distorted by human hands, but God's judgment is eternal and flawless.
“Dear ones, do not be afraid and do not grieve. People can chain the body, but never faith. As the apostle writes, ‘The word of God is not chained,’” he wrote in his letter.
Bishop Mkrtich also urged the faithful to remain steadfast in their faith and not to weaken during times of trial. “Remember, nothing can separate us from the love of Christ—neither sorrow, nor persecution, nor slander. It is this love that binds us together as shepherd and flock,” he noted, concluding his letter with a blessing.
It is worth mentioning that the leaders of the 'Sacred Struggle' movement, Archbishop Bagrat Galstanyan, Shirak Diocesan Archbishop Mikayel Ajapakhyan, and Garigin Arsenyan, the secretary of the Aragatsotn Diocese, are also in custody.
